The Life of Jimmy Governor Bill Gammage , 1979 single work review
— Appears in: Aboriginal History , vol. 3 no. 1-2 1979; (p. 163-164)

— Review of The Life of Jimmy Governor Brian Davies , 1979 single work biography
Gammage notes that Brian Davies is a journalist, and The Life of Jimmy Governor is a journalist's book. The research is conscientious but stops once the story is told. This is a good story, with an awareness of the injustice with which white has treated black in Australia, but does not touch the deeper questions with which this treatment provokes...
